SPEED(1SSL) OpenSSL SPEED(1SSL)
NAME
speed - test library performance
SYNOPSIS
openssl speed [-engine id] [md2] [mdc2] [md5] [hmac] [sha1] [rmd160] [idea-cbc] [rc2-cbc]
[rc5-cbc] [bf-cbc] [des-cbc] [des-ede3] [rc4] [rsa512] [rsa1024] [rsa2048] [rsa4096]
[dsa512] [dsa1024] [dsa2048] [idea] [rc2] [des] [rsa] [blowfish]
DESCRIPTION
This command is used to test the performance of cryptographic algorithms.
OPTIONS
-engine id
specifying an engine (by its unique id string) will cause speed to attempt to obtain a
functional reference to the specified engine, thus initialising it if needed. The
engine will then be set as the default for all available algorithms.
[zero or more test algorithms]
If any options are given, speed tests those algorithms, otherwise all of the above are
tested.
